The first table below looks at the demand for Data Modelling skills in IT contracts advertised for the Birmingham region. Included is a guide to the average contractor rates offered in IT contracts that have cited Data Modelling over the 3 months to 17 May 2013 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years. The second table is for comparison and provides aggregates for all of the Processes & Methodologies category for the Birmingham region.

Note that daily contractor rates and hourly contractor rates are treated separately. When calculating average contractor rates, daily rates are not derived from quoted hourly rates or vice versa.
